Some thoughts on the Cincinnati game:
  • We fans can be complacent about AAC opponents. But tonight’s game against a good Bearcat team which hasn’t lost at home, was a potential trap game that could have impacted UConn’s seeding in the Big Dance. This was an important win for the Huskies, and they showed up with the most impressive half of basketball I’ve seen all season.
  • In what has become something of a pattern, UConn’s offense struggled somewhat to start the game, but the Huskies defense continues to suffocate opponents until the offense gets on track.
  • In a day when Liv wasn’t at her best, everyone else stepped up nicely. This was probably the best combined effort by both freshmen together in one game. Megan and Crystal were their dependable selves, and we can all celebrate the return of Christyn Williams. Add in some nice minutes from Kyla and Molly and this was as good a team effort as we’ve seen in a while.
  • Lots of really nice things happened in this game. UConn was on fire from the arc, making their first six 3-pt shots. The Huskies made their first 9 FT’s, 11/13 overall. In the first half UConn blocked 6 Cincinnati shots, while holding the Bearcats to 18% shooting.
  • SNY zeroed in on Jamelle a couple times. You know she had to be thoroughly enjoying the xxx-whipping that the Huskies were handing out to the Bearcats, but her expression was limited to one of quiet intensity. I’m guessing she’ll be high-fiving everyone in the locker room.
